The Future of Meat Production

Methane is a powerful greenhouse gas. It traps 20 times more heat than carbon dioxide. The global meat industry is responsible for 30% of the world's methane production. Raising livestock animals also has a serious effect on climate change. For some people, growing meat in laboratories may be the solution to this problem. Meat grown with this method is usually called cultured meat or in vitro meat. A few cells from a cow could grow thousands of pounds of beef. But the technology for in vitro meat is still very new and it is still very expensive.
